  • Why the double column?
    As a side note, Librera reader has option to view pages by halves. So you first scroll through the left column, then right. Bookmarks recognize the layout and will send you to proper page. Reading full width of PDF would be a pain on mobile. Source: about 1 year ago
  • Suggest android pdf reader with text selection or build in region translate.
    Librera can certainly do this. BUT not all pdf files are created equal. Internally pdf's do not have to have text. They can and sometimes do, but the text can also be poorly implemented. And it is up to the reader to make sense of what the text is trying to do, which leads to problems. If the pdf was born digital it is less of a problem, but they can still arise.
